HyperScribe™ T7 High Yield RNA Synthesis Kit Plus performs in vitro RNA transcription experiment in a relatively short time using T7 RNA polymerase. The kit is designed for high yields of RNA transcripts, highly specific radiolabeled RNA probes and to obtain capped, dye-labeled or biotinylated RNA incorporated modified nucleotides.
RNA synthesized using this kit covers a wide range of applications, such as in vitro translation, antisense RNA and RNAi experiments, RNA vaccines, RNA structure and function studies, ribozyme biochemistry, RNase protein experiments and probe-based hybridization blots.
The kit contains sufficient reagents to carry out 25/50/100 reactions, 20 μL each time. Up to 100 μg of RNA can be generated with 1 μg of control template per standard reaction. Each 25/50/100 reactions kit can produce up to 4.5 mg/9 mg/18 mg RNA.
